CVE-2023-48010 affects STMicroelectronics SPC58 PowerPC microcontrollers. The vulnerability stems from a missing protection mechanism for an alternate hardware interface. Specifically, code running as Supervisor on the SPC58 PowerPC microcontrollers can disable the System Memory Protection Unit. This allows the code to gain unrestricted read/write access to protected assets.
